Covid-19

COVID-19 is highly contagious. All age groups can contract COVID-19; symptoms may manifest 2-14 days after exposure or not at all. COVID-19 most significantly affects respiratory & pulmonary functions; cardiac
injury noted in some hospitalized cases. Response to virus varies by person:

  • Infected person is asymptomatic
  • Infected person experiences mild symptoms for 1-3 days (ex. fever, headache, skin rash, loss of energy, etc.) then recovers
  • Infected person experiences moderate to severe flu-like symptoms with non-productive cough and some trouble breathing for 1-3 weeks (no hospital visits)
  • Infected person experiences significant respiratory distress and needs medical/hospital intervention to recover/survive

We currently offer two Covid-19 field testing methods.

TESTING FOR CURRENT INFECTIONS: Viral Tests
● Samples are taken from your respiratory system (such as swabs of the inside of the nose) and
analyzed to determine if you currently have an infection with SARS-CoV-2, the virus that causes
COVID-19.
● Some tests are point-of-care tests, meaning results may be available at the testing site in less
than an hour. Other tests must be sent to a laboratory to analyze, a process that takes 1-2 days
once received by the lab.

TESTING FOR PAST INFECTION: Antibody Tests
● A blood sample is taken and analyzed for the presence of the antibodies for COVID-19.
Antibodies are proteins your body develops to fight off an infection; they are disease specific
and usually provide future immunity. Presence of the antibody in the blood will confirm if you
had a past infection with the virus.
● Depending on when someone was infected and the timing of the test, the test may not find
antibodies in someone with a current COVID-19 infection. As such, antibody tests should not be
used to diagnose COVID-19.

● SARS-CoV-2: Virus that causes COVID-19 infection. This virus encodes for different proteins, including the nucieocapsid (N) protein that is part of a shell that encapsulates the viral RNA.
● IgM antibody: Produced first, reflects early infection (Figure 1)
● IgG antibody: Reflects later infection and, eventually, long-term immunity (Figure 1). At this time, it is not known if a person with COVID-19 related antibodies has immunity.
